Blank of congress must propose blank of states must ratify How many amendments have been added to the constitution blank?

Two-thirds of Congress must propose an amendment, and three-fourths of states must ratify it. There have been 27 amendments added to the Constitution as of now.

How many amendments were originally proposed and submitted to Congress as the initial draft of the Bill of Rights?

12 but 2 were not ratified by the states.

What did the founding fathers believe in article v do you feel this is important?

The Founding Fathers had concerns that the newly created federal government could lose the trust and confidence of the public. Thus they created the option in Article V for a convention of state delegates that could propose constitutional amendments as an alternative to Congress proposing amendments. In either case, proposed amendments would still have to be ratified by the states according to the requirements of Article V. Clearly, the founders feared that Congress might not propose amendments that impacted Congress itself. That is exactly what has happened. The public has lost confidence in Congress and Congress has refused to convene the first Article V convention, despite many hundreds of requests for one from the states.
